Variables to Take into consideration



When picking the right dimension Skip bin for your project, a number of elements should be taken into account.

Initially, analyze the amount and type of waste you'll be throwing away. Different jobs generate varying types and quantities of waste, so recognizing your waste stream is vital.

Take into consideration the area readily available on your building for the Skip bin. Make certain that the chosen bin dimension can fit in the assigned location without creating blockage.

An additional aspect to take into consideration is the period of your task. Longer jobs may require bigger Skip containers or even more regular emptying to suit the waste created in time.

Think about any kind of possible limitations in your area, such as weight limitations or prohibited products, to ensure conformity with policies.

Lastly, factor in your budget and select a miss bin dimension that lines up with your monetary restraints while still meeting your garbage disposal needs.

Estimating Waste Quantity



To properly pick the best size Skip container for your task, you have to initially estimate the quantity of waste you'll be getting rid of. One way to do this is by aesthetically examining the products you prepare to throw away and approximately estimating their complete volume in cubic meters.

Alternatively, you can use on the internet tools or waste volume calculators to assist you establish the approximate amount of waste you'll have. Bear in mind that it's much better to somewhat overestimate than to ignore, as it's even more cost-efficient to work with a slightly bigger Skip container than to buy an extra one if you lack area.



If you're still unsure, think about inquiring from waste management professionals that can provide assistance based on the kind of project you're carrying out. By properly estimating your waste quantity, you'll be better furnished to pick the ideal Skip bin dimension for your requirements.

Understanding Bin Dimensions



Understanding bin dimensions is essential when picking the suitable Skip container dimension for your task. Skip containers been available in different measurements, typically gauged in cubic meters.

The dimensions of a miss container refer to its length, size, and height. By understanding these measurements, you can visualize how much waste the bin can hold and whether it will match your requirements.

For example, a 2 cubic meter Skip container might have measurements of approximately 1.8 meters in size, 1.4 meters in size, and 0.9 meters in height. Knowing these measurements can aid you figure out if the Skip bin will suit your desired place and if it can accommodate the quantity of waste you prepare for producing.

Always think about the space you have offered for the Skip container and make certain that its measurements line up with your job demands to prevent any kind of issues throughout waste disposal.
